What Does 'Feed Rot' Mean?

The degraded, repetitive state a personal feed reaches after too much doomscrolling β€” the same handful of recycled clips and formats looping back no matter how far you scroll.

REAL-WORLD EXAMPLE

"My feed rot is so bad it's showing me the same three trends from two months ago."

LORE & ORIGIN

Named by users noticing their 'For You' pages had stopped surfacing anything new, describing the feed itself as decaying rather than describing the user's own mental state.
